Raimunde is a feminine form of the Germanic name Raimund, derived from the Old High German elements 'ragin' meaning 'advice' or 'counsel' and 'mund' meaning 'protector'. The name historically conveyed a sense of wise guardianship and strategic counsel, common in medieval Germanic nobility and leadership roles. It reflects a legacy of strength, wisdom, and protection.
Raimunde holds cultural significance primarily in German-speaking countries, where it reflects the medieval tradition of names that combined qualities of wisdom and protection. It is less common today but carries a historic gravitas linked to nobility and strong female figures in folklore and literature.
